WebJan 23, 2024 · Jan 22, 2024. Pyridinium chlorochromate ( PCC) is a milder version of chromic acid. PCC oxidizes alcohols one rung up the oxidation ladder, from primary alcohols to aldehydes and from secondary alcohols to ketones. WebPyridinium chlorochromate (PCC) is a yellow-orange salt with the formula [C 5 H 5 NH] + [CrO 3 Cl] −.It is a reagent in organic synthesis used primarily for oxidation of alcohols to … WebPCC is a mild oxidizing agent that selectively oxidizes sulfides to sulfoxides without further oxidation to sulfones. Applications and Relevance of PCC in Organic Synthesis. PCC is a versatile reagent that has numerous applications in organic synthesis. It is commonly used in the oxidation of alcohols to aldehydes and ketones.

WebNov 9, 2024 · Pyridinium chlorochromate (PCC) is an oxidizing agent which can oxidized alcohols to aldehydes and ketones. PCC is formed from the reaction between pyridine, chromium trioxide, and hydrochloric acid. Chlorochromatic acid can be prepared by the dissolution of chromium trioxide in aqueous hydrochloric acid.
